I’m going to take off my chef’s hat for a minute and slip into some nurse’s scrubs to discuss Chicken Alfredo’s health check
Egg shell temperature came in at 99.7 anything between 98.5 and 101.5 is considered to be acceptable 100.0 is the ideal target View attachment 3784095
Her weight tonight was 57 grams. I didn’t write every eggs starting weight but I know that all of the eggs laid by Oreo started between 60 and 65 grams. That would put her target weight 54.9-58.7 on day 18 today is day 16 so she is right on target
View attachment 3784096
Veins look really good. But didn’t photograph all that well. Movement was a little slow but she is definitely moving around. I think I caught her while she was resting or possibly even asleep tonight. All in all I believe she is very healthy. View attachment 3784097
